Kinds Of Powertools Available in the UK
UK powertools can be broadly classified into two classifications: corded and cordless tools. Each type has its own applications, strengths, and weak points.
Corded Powertools
Corded tools are powered through an electric outlet and are understood for their constant power supply. They are normally used for more comprehensive tasks that require extended usage. Some common types of corded powertools consist of:
Drills
Impact Drills: Effective for drilling into difficult materials like concrete and masonry.Hammer Drills: Suitable for professional and commercial jobs, providing high torque.
Saws
Circular Saws: Ideal for making fast, straight cuts in different products.Miter Saws: Perfect for accurate angled cuts.Table Saws: Excellent for making long, straight cuts rapidly.
Sanders
Belt Sanders: Suitable for big surface area locations.Orbital Sanders: Great for fine finishing.
Mills
Angle Grinders: Versatile tools for cutting, grinding, and polishing tasks.Cordless Powertools
Cordless powertools run on batteries, making them more portable and flexible for tight spaces. However, their efficiency can decline as battery life lessens. Common cordless powertools include:
Drills
Cordless Drills: Versatile for different drilling applications.Cordless Impact Drivers: Specifically developed for driving screws.
Saws
Cordless Circular Saws: Portable for cutting in different task sites.Reciprocating Saws: Ideal for demolition and rough cuts.
Securing Tools
Nail Guns: Perfect for protecting wood components without manual effort.
Other Tools

Q1: What security gear should I use when using powertools?A1: Always wear appropriate safety equipment, including safety goggles, gloves, ear security, and dust masks.
Q2: How can I maintain my powertools?A2: Regular maintenance consists of cleansing, lubricating, and examining for wear on parts. Always describe the producer's standards for specifics.
